Directed by Zhora Kryzhovnikov became a laureate V National Award in the field of web content in the category “Best Director of an Internet Series” for the film “The Boy’s Word. Blood on the asphalt.” The series itself received a prize in the “Best Internet Series” category. The award ceremony takes place in the Digital Business Space in Moscow.

As a TASS correspondent reports, the director himself was not present at the award ceremony – producer Fyodor Bondarchuk took the award instead. In the category “Best Actress in an Internet Series”, Lyubov Aksenova won for her role in the film “Living Life”, the best actors were Nikita Efremov for the series “The Librarian” and Ivan Yankovsky for his role in “The Boy’s Word”.

The National Web Content Awards have been presented since 2018. The award winners are the most notable projects and prominent personalities of Russian Internet content.
